Protecting Your System from Zip File Malware: A Guide

Zip files can be a handy way to store multiple documents, but they can also be a vehicle for malicious software known as malware. Before extracting a zip file, it's crucial to take measures to protect your system from security threats.

  • Prioritize this: only download zip files from reliable websites. Avoid clicking on links files from suspicious emails or websites.
  • Regularly check any downloaded zip file with a reputable antivirus program before extracting its contents. This will help detect any potential malware hidden within the files.
  • Exercise caution when unzipping files. Do not unzip files in system folders. Choose a safe and isolated location for extracting the contents of zip files.

By following these simple tips, you can minimize the risk of malware infection from zip files and keep your computer safe and secure. Remember, vigilance is key when it comes to cybersecurity. Stay informed about the latest threats and best practices to protect yourself online.

Protecting Your Zip Files: Recognizing and Mitigating Threats

Zip files are popular for transporting files, but they can also be a target for malicious entities. Knowing the common risks associated with zip file safety is crucial for safeguarding your data. One major risk is the inclusion of malware into zip files, which can damage your system when uncompressed. Another risk is compromising sensitive information stored within zip containers.

  • Employ strong passwords for encrypted zip files.
  • Analyze zip files for unusual activity before extracting them.
  • Download zip files only from legitimate sources.
